Net Lawman Ltd is an English company operated by Andrew R. Taylor. Most legal work is undertaken by Andrew and Rajeev Goswami, assisted by English barristers for employment specialist work, and Rajeev's small team of Indian lawyers, as required.
|
|
|
Andrew Rhodes Taylor BA(Econ)
|
|

Andrew has a degree in economics and was an English solicitor for over 20 years. He resigned voluntarily as a solicitor in order to operate Net Lawman with unrestricted advertising. He has specialised primarily in commercial and company law. Working in a high street practice, he has covered a wide range of law. During that time, he has also been involved as a director and shareholder in a number of businesses, principally connected with commercial property or the Internet.
The document templates sold by Net Lawman have been drawn by Andrew and a small team of specialist solicitors and barristers. The documents are regularly updated to take account of new law.

How we work
The Net Lawman service is designed to fill a gap between on the one hand the mass of “contractual” letters and messages produced by every business every day with confidence and on the other hand those cases where solicitor help is essential.
In other words, if you require help, you can probably find it here, very quickly and at low cost.
Because we are not solicitors, we are not permitted to offer a full range of legal services. But within the range we offer, we aim to provide a service second to none. You will find us fast, receptive and efficient.
Net Lawman legal advice is provided on a “no liability” basis. The business is not regulated by The Law Society.

Rajeev Goswami BSc, LLB, ACS, ACIS, MICA, ADSM, Dip. IPR
|
|
|
Rajeev Goswami is a lawyer working from India where his small team provides the commercial law support for Net Lawman.
Rajeev studied at Bareilly College (MJPR University) where he obtained a bachelor's degree in science. He then moved on to Delhi University where he obtained a law degree. He also enjoys the following qualifications and memberships:
|
-
Associate Member of the Institute of Company Secretaries of India (from which he received the 'Silver Medal' for all India highest marks in Corporate Laws paper.)
-
Associate Member of the (English) Institute of Chartered Secretaries and Administrators.
-
Advanced Diploma in Sales Management from National Institute of Sales, India and a Diploma in IP Law from the World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O) which serves as a center of excellence in teaching, training and research in IP.
-
Member of the Indian Council of Arbitration.
|
|
|
|
India is a common law jurisdiction, originally based on English law. Rajeev has first hand knowledge of English corporate law after studying for the above qualifications. He has been practicing Corporate and IP law for over 6 years.
He has also held the position of Partner (Head – IP division) in a leading Indian law firm before becoming associated with Andrew Taylor in Net Lawman. |
